A Chinese Long March 7A rocket exploded shortly after liftoff on Monday, Aug. 10, 2026 [1], resulting in a total launch failure [2].

The incident disrupts China's orbital delivery schedule and marks a significant setback for a rocket series that had maintained a strong track record since its inception.

The rocket launched from the Wenchang Satellite Launch Center in Hainan Province [2]. According to reports, the vehicle suffered an in-flight anomaly that led to the explosion [2]. The failure occurred between 85 [4] and 90 seconds [5] after the rocket left the pad.

This event represents the first failure for the Long March 7A since its maiden flight in March 2020 [3]. The rocket is a key component of China's strategy to increase the frequency, and reliability, of its satellite deployments.

Chinese officials have not yet released a detailed technical report on the cause of the anomaly. The explosion was visible from the launch site, with debris falling as the vehicle broke apart in the atmosphere [1].

Investigators are expected to analyze telemetry data to determine if the anomaly was caused by a mechanical failure or a software error. The Wenchang facility is China's primary hub for heavy-lift launches, and any prolonged grounding of the Long March 7A could delay multiple upcoming missions [2].
